Abstract

Although amorphous calcium phosphate has been a mature research object in the medicine field, its application in drug carriers remains restricted due to its easy agglomeration and poor dispersion stability. Accordingly, the ACP was modified with hyaluronic acid (HA) and hexametaphosphate ((NaPO3)6), the amorphous structure can be kept for more than 3 months based on HA stabilizers, the dispersion can be maintained for about one month owing to the (NaPO3)6. In vitro, the Cur-HA-ACP-(NaPO3)6 nanoparticles showed high drug loading, good pH response performance and favorable antitumor ability. Overall, Cur loaded HA-ACP nanoparticles exhibited a great potential for anticancer chemotherapeutics.
